Jack Henry & Associates, Inc.JKHYInformation Technology

Provides core processing, payment services, and complementary software to community and regional banks and credit unions. Revenue is anchored by hosted platforms and recurring electronic payments under multiyear contracts, with core relationships supporting cross-sales of Banno digital banking, treasury, lending, and fraud tools.

Based in Monett, Missouri, provides core processing, payment processing, and complementary software and services to community and regional banks and credit unions. Core systems automate deposit, lending, general-ledger, and accountholder records; payments span card, ACH, bill pay, remote deposit, ATM, and wire workflows; complementary products cover Banno digital banking, treasury, account opening, lending, fraud, and risk management.

Earns most support and service revenue from hosted private- and public-cloud services and recurring electronic payments, typically under multiyear contracts, while also licensing on-premise software and reselling hardware. Long client relationships support cross-selling across core and core-agnostic products, and the Jack Henry Platform is extending delivery through public-cloud-native, API-first services. Operations remain subject to banking-agency examinations, evolving financial regulation, cybersecurity demands, and third-party technology dependencies.

A 13F quarter can total more than the shares outstanding — sub-advisers file the same block twice, and a filer's own share count can be a quarter stale. No split is drawn from it.
